Question 1

A corporation executive believes that his inspiration messages in the company newsletter increase productivity, and the newsletter should therefore come out more often. The newsletter is published in February, April, June, August, October and December. The executive compares productivity in January (which does not have a newsletter) with productivity in February (which does have a newsletter), then compares March’s productivity with April’s, etc.

Required:

(i) What do you understand by the term research? Explain its significance in modern times. [4 Marks]

(ii) Come up with a possible title to this kind of research. [2 Marks]

(iii) Write a problem statement on the above issues. [4 Marks]

(iv) Which research design would be most appropriate for this study and why [4 Marks]

(v) Come up with at least two objectives [2 Marks]

(vi) Come up with the hypothesis to the problem [2 Marks]

(vii) Explain the sampling plan you would employ for this study [4 Marks]

(viii) What are the main characteristics of a good sampling design? [4 Marks]

(ix) How would you test for validity and reliability of your study? [4 Marks]
